Job Title: Qualified Mental Health ProfessionalJob Summary

Wexford Health is seeking a qualified mental health professional to provide social work services to patients receiving mental health services in a correctional setting. The ideal candidate will have a Master's degree in a mental health area and a current license in one of the following: Licensed Social Worker (LSW),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W),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C), Licensed Clinical Professional Counselor (LCPC),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ist (LMFT), or Associate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ist (ALMFT).

Responsibilities
  • Provide clinical screenings and assessments for treatment needs of offenders referred by medical, counseling, security, or other center staff.
  • Provide crisis intervention counseling, brief therapy, and group therapy as indicated for Center residents.
  • Provide consultation on mental health issues to the center medical staff.
  • Provide staff training to center personnel on mental health issues.
  • Monitor the provisions of crisis services and maintain required documentation.
  • Provide services in compliance with all Administrative Directives Departmental Rules.
Requirements
  • Current license in one of the following: LSW, LCSW, LPC, LCPC, LMFT, or ALMFT.
  • Master's degree in a mental health area.
  • CPR certification.
